Comprehending Built-In Appliances
Built-in appliances are devices developed to be integrated into kitchen or home structures perfectly. Unlike freestanding appliances, which can be moved and repositioned, Built In Appliances-in models are normally set up into cabinetry or specific built-in areas during brand-new home building or considerable renovations. This permits for a cohesive style, optimizing performance while improving visual appeal.

Kinds Of Built-In Appliances
The most common categories of built-in appliances consist of:
| Type | Description | Examples |
|---|---|---|
| Cooking Appliances | Include ovens, microwaves, and stovetops that can be built into the cabinetry. | Built-in ovens, microwave drawers, induction cooktops |
| Refrigeration | Appliances that blend into the kitchen while preserving their cooling functions. | Built-in fridges, wine coolers |
| Dishwashing | Dishwashing machines designed to be set up behind kitchen cabinetry doors for a structured look. | Integrated dishwashers |
| Laundry | Appliances like washers and clothes dryers created to fit neatly into utility room. | Built-in washing devices, mix washer-dryer units |
| Other | A classification that might consist of ventilation hoods, coffee makers, and custom appliances. | Built-in coffee machines, warming drawers |
Benefits of Built-In Appliances
1. Area Efficiency
Built-in appliances are developed to use area more efficiently. They can be tailored to fit comfortably within existing cabinets or unique architectural functions of a home.
2. Visual Appeal
The integration of appliances permits property owners to produce a tidy and cohesive appearance. The absence of large machines promotes a neat environment, making areas, particularly cooking areas, look more spacious and organized.
3. Enhanced Functionality
Numerous built-in appliances come with advanced features, enabling users to optimize their cooking efforts. The smooth style also motivates efficient workflow in the kitchen, a vital aspect for cooking enthusiasts.
4. Increased Property Value
Premium built-in appliances frequently add considerable worth to homes, as they show contemporary design and practical efficiency. Potential buyers are typically attracted to homes geared up with these upgraded functions.
5. Customization Options
Homeowners can pick from a range of surfaces, designs, and innovations, allowing them to personalize their area. Whether selecting stainless steel, panel-ready choices, or special colors, there is an almost limitless variety of choices.
Design Considerations for Built-In Appliances
While the combination of built-in appliances can considerably improve the look and function of an area, certain style considerations must be considered:
- Measurements: Accurate measurements are vital for guaranteeing an appropriate fit within cabinets.
- Ventilation: Proper ventilation is important for cooking appliances to avoid overheating and to maintain air quality.
- Power Supply: It's important to make sure that the essential electrical and pipes infrastructure is in location before setting up built-in appliances.
- Availability: Design should prioritize user accessibility to guarantee that utensils, appliances, and workspace are within easy reach.
- Aesthetic Compatibility: All built-in appliances should be picked to match the style style of the home.
Regularly Asked Questions About Built-in Appliances
1. Are built-in appliances more costly than freestanding ones?
Built-in appliances tend to be more pricey due to their customized nature and setup procedures. Nevertheless, the added value and advantages can justify the investment, specifically in premium styles and technologies.
2. Can built-in appliances be moved easily?
No, built-in appliances are normally not designed to be moved. They are installed into kitchen cabinetry, making relocation hard and typically requiring substantial effort and remodeling.
3. How do I preserve built-in appliances?
Upkeep depends on the type of device. Routine cleansing is suggested in addition to periodic look for any service concerns. Always describe the maker's standards for specific maintenance needs.
4. Are built-in appliances energy-efficient?
Numerous built-in appliances are developed to be more energy-efficient than older or freestanding designs, frequently equipped with functions that reduce energy consumption.
5. Can I set up built-in appliances myself?
While some homeowners may select to install appliances themselves, it's often advisable to hire a professional, particularly for electrical or plumbing connections. Proper installation guarantees security and optimal efficiency.
